Every year, the GEC Palakkad cutoff is announced based on the marks obtained by candidates in the KEAM entrance exam, which determines how many seats are available for B.Tech admission. Those who meet the GEC Palakkad 2023 cut-off will be eligible for KEAM counselling. The Government Engineering College Palakkad cutoff will be determined based on candidate's performance in the KEAM exam. The GEC Palakkad cut off 2023 is determined by a number of factors, including the overall exam difficulty level, the number of test takers, the type of course, seat availability, previous year cutoff trends, and so on. To be eligible for seat allotment, candidates must obtain a KEAM rank between the GEC Palakkad opening and closing ranks.

Courses | Closing Rank |
B.Tech Computer Science Engineering | 16153 |
B.Tech Electronics & Communication Engineering | 33535 |
B.Tech Civil Engineering | 35713 |
B.Tech Electrical and Electronics Engineering | 36840 |
B.Tech Information Technology | 38469 |
B.Tech Mechanical Engineering | 46449 |

Overall: Overall its good. Gec Palakkad is situated is so much inward from the main town. It has a vibrant natural feeling along with a good air. Also staffs are good
Placement: Placements vary according to your departments. Some departments have high placements while some have low. But it is enough for the students and high value companies will come
Infrastructure: Gec Palakkad doesn’t have a lot of buildings but it is enough for the six departments and others. Since the infrastructure is less there is a whole lot space for new to be build
Faculty: Faculties here are with good knowledge and good personality. Also different departments varies the faculties. There are no same faculties for different departments
Hostel: Govt mens and ladies hostel is good. There are so many private hostels but have to look up the quality by checking them. Only limited seats are in govt hostel
